|
|
@@ -93,7 +93,7 @@ export const myMixin = {
|
|
|
console.log(e);
|
|
|
return this.syncClassData(classData);
|
|
|
}
|
|
|
- let courseGrade = await this.ajax.get(this.$store.state.api + "getClassById", { id: classData.courseGrade });
|
|
|
+ let courseGrade = classData.courseGrade ? await this.ajax.get(this.$store.state.api + "getClassById", { id: classData.courseGrade }) : '';
|
|
|
let coursePackageName = await this.ajax.get(this.$store.state.api + "getCopyCourseName", { id: classData.courseId });
|
|
|
let params = {
|
|
|
"serverName": "深教AI6",
|
|
|
@@ -107,7 +107,7 @@ export const myMixin = {
|
|
|
"coursePackageName": coursePackageName.data[0][0].title,
|
|
|
"courseId": classData.courseId,
|
|
|
"courseName": classData.title,
|
|
|
- "courseGrade": courseGrade.data[0][0].name,
|
|
|
+ "courseGrade": courseGrade ? courseGrade.data[0][0].name : '无年级',
|
|
|
"courseTime": classData.courseTime,
|
|
|
"startTime": classData.startTime,
|
|
|
"endTime": classData.endTime
|
|
|
@@ -137,7 +137,7 @@ export const myMixin = {
|
|
|
console.log(e);
|
|
|
return this.syncClassData(classData);
|
|
|
}
|
|
|
- let courseGrade = await this.ajax.get(this.$store.state.api + "getClassById", { id: classData.courseGrade });
|
|
|
+ let courseGrade = classData.courseGrade ? await this.ajax.get(this.$store.state.api + "getClassById", { id: classData.courseGrade }) : '';
|
|
|
let coursePackageName = await this.ajax.get(this.$store.state.api + "getCopyCourseName", { id: classData.courseId });
|
|
|
let params = {
|
|
|
"serverName": "深教AI6",
|
|
|
@@ -151,7 +151,7 @@ export const myMixin = {
|
|
|
"coursePackageName": coursePackageName.data[0][0].title,
|
|
|
"courseId": classData.courseId,
|
|
|
"courseName": classData.title,
|
|
|
- "courseGrade": courseGrade.data[0][0].name,
|
|
|
+ "courseGrade": courseGrade ? courseGrade.data[0][0].name : '无年级',
|
|
|
"courseTime": classData.courseTime,
|
|
|
"startTime": classData.startTime,
|
|
|
"endTime": classData.endTime
|